Rest of India on 10 March 2016 won the Irani Cup Cricket title. In the match played in Mumbai, Rest of India defeated 41-time Ranji Champions Mumbai by four wickets.

Rest of India overhauled the victory target of 480 by making 482 for 6 on the fifth and final day in Mumbai.

Rest of India’s chase was also the best-ever run-chase in the Irani history. It bettered Rest’s 424, chasing 421 set by Delhi at the Ferozshah Kotla in 1982-83.

• Man-of-the-match - Karun Nair

• The final scores: Mumbai-603 and 182; Rest of India - 306 and 482 for 6

About Irani Cup

The Irani Cup (earlier called Irani Trophy) tournament was conceived during the 1959-60 season to mark the completion of 25 years of the Ranji Trophy championship.

It was named after the late ZR Irani, who was associated with the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) from its inception in 1928, till his death in 1970. The fixture is always played between the previous year's Ranji Trophy winners and the Rest of India Team.
